It’s the 31st year when mango growers from across the country will gather under one roof with their choicest produce, to compete for the top slots that offer cash prizes to the best mango varieties. So, when you visit this year’s Mango Festival at Dilli Haat, Janak Puri, that begins July 5, you will be able to taste Virat Kohli, ahem, the mango called Virat Kohli. ( Instagram/indiancricketteam )The organisers of the festival validate that it’s the first time that cricket fever has gripped the mango growers. “Over the years, the Mango Festival has become one of the most-awaited events of the season.
